The location is fantastic mountain views in every direction. The lodge is lovely spacious and well equipped. Plenty of space around the lodges for children to safely play. Lots of great walks from the lodge and plenty more walks not far away as well. We went out to glenshee ski centre and on the chair lift to top of cairnwell mountain. We went to braemar, to linn of Dee, to balmoral castle, Pitlochry and glamis castle all within a 40 min drive of lodge and all well worthy of a visit. And at end of day relax in your private hot tub soaking in the great views. We had an amazing time and hope to return soon 😃 next time we gonna try the sauna in our lodge 🤞
